VUF15259 is a novel inhibitor of Hbp secretion, activating σE stress, impairing Hbp secretion and decreasing the abundance of OMPs, consistent with impaired BAM function.

Chemical Formula: C13H19Cl3N2O

Exact Mass: 324.0563

Molecular Weight: 325.66

Elemental Analysis: C, 47.95; H, 5.88; Cl, 32.66; N, 8.60; O, 4.91
